Google Not At All Intimidated by Microsoft's Bing


According to Google’s CEO Eric Schmidt, there’s little to no worry about Microsoft’s Bing threatening their already massive share of the search engine market.

“It's not the first entry for Microsoft. They do this about once a year,” said Schmidt in an interview earlier this week. “I don't think Bing's arrival has changed what we're doing. We are about search, we're about making things enormously successful, by virtue of innovation.”


He continued on a lighter note, stating, “Google is about getting all the information and organizing it. Yahoo has a different strategy. We think ultimately Bing will evolve to a different strategy as well.”

Still though, Google isn’t ignoring the potential threat that Bing poses. They’re set to review possibilities with their executive committee later in the week.
